Transaction 4a3bbfa117a5ad24c809f5b2aaf07aef08218eabca52fb15c436e1dc03995911

1 Input
2 Outputs
  • 4a3bbfa117a5ad24c809f5b2aaf07aef08218eabca52fb15c436e1dc03995911:0
  • value  25000000
    address  3Fp8hrQSw8MBaRwDVcKatb1qivu7J9ss3P
  • 4a3bbfa117a5ad24c809f5b2aaf07aef08218eabca52fb15c436e1dc03995911:1
  • value  5837287774
    address  15gHxeimK51jaiWzdmy2t6byeeQXA2EM5e